Buying Guide: Key Considerations For 5×114.3 To 5×100 Adapters
- Center bore compatibility: Ensure the adapter’s hub bore matches your vehicle’s hub to avoid vibrations or wobble. If the bore is larger than the wheel bore, hub rings may be required.
- Adapter thickness: 1 inch vs 15 mm adapters affect wheel offset and braking clearance. Choose thickness based on wheel clearance and desired stance.
- Stud grade and torque: Look for high-grade studs (e.g., 12.9) and follow torque specs (commonly 70-80 ft-lbs). Proper torque prevents loosening and enhances safety.
- Hub-centric design: Hubcentric adapters reduce runout and vibrations by aligning with the wheel hub. This is especially important for daily driving and highway use.
- Fitment accuracy: Verify exact year/make/model compatibility. Some listings cover broad model ranges; double-check the vehicle’s exact bolt pattern and bore size.
- Stud trimming considerations: Some 15 mm adapters require trimming factory studs for a flush mount. Plan for appropriate tools and potential professional installation.
- Material and finish: Aluminum alloys (forged) provide strength with lighter weight; avoid corrosion-prone finishes in harsh climates without protective coatings.
FAQ
- Q: Can these adapters be used on all 5×114.3 to 5×100 conversions?
A: Not universally. Check the center bore size and wheel compatibility for your exact vehicle to ensure safe fitment. - Q: Do I need hub rings when using these adapters?
A: It depends on the center bore of your wheels versus the adapter. If the wheel bore is larger, hub rings may be necessary for precise centering. - Q: Is a professional installation recommended?
A: Yes. Correct torque, alignment, and stud trimming (when required) are crucial for safe operation and road performance. - Q: Are there any safety risks with 15 mm adapters?
